CHAPTER 2. SAFETY REQUIREMENTS
AND WARNINGS
SAFETY REQUIREMENTS
1. When operating the motor vehicle, it is necessary to observe
road trafc regulations and safety requirements, keep the motor
vehicle in good repair, and carry out timely maintenance and cor-
rect any possible malfunctions, in order to avoid injury to yourself
and others.
2. A driver is responsible for the passengers. Therefore, a driver
must ensure that his or her passengers observe all safety rules. Be
specially careful when children are in the motor vehicle. Do not
leave children unattended in the motor vehicle.
3. It is prohibited to switch off the ignition, and remove the key
from the ignition starter switch, when driving the motor vehicle.
4. When leaving the motor vehicle, do not leave door keys and
ignition keys inside.
5. Before opening a door, ensure that it will not be a hindrance
for other road users.
Before closing a door, make sure it will not catch someone or
something.
It is prohibited to drive the motor vehicle with any door being
opened.
6. Do not adjust the tilt angle of the steering column when
driving the motor vehicle.
7. Do not adjust the driver seat when driving the motor vehicle.
8. Observe the requirements of safe power window usage.
Do not allow children to use power windows.
9. It is prohibited to use lamps that are not required by design.
10. Seatbelts are an efcient means of driver and passenger
protection against drastic consequences of trafc accidents.
Use of seatbelts is mandatory!
11. Worn, damaged, underinated or overpressured tires, warped
wheels or wheel unfastening can cause a car crash.
